Discover the vibrant kingdom of Bhutan in this expansive, feature-packed tour. Starting with a visit to the highly regarded Ta Dzong Museum in Paro, filled with antique Thanka paintings, textiles, weapons and armour. In Thimphu, you’ll visit the Bhutan Post with its world famous stamps before moving on to revel in the culture of the National Folk History Museum.You’ll gasp at the stunning scenery as we take you along the Dochula pass to see more important cultural and historical sites where culture and beauty provide a heady mix as we take you to the Tachogang Temple and the Tango Monastery to name but a few. After visiting the Gangtey Conservation Grounds, we head back to Paro where you will take a leisurely hike to see the Taktsang Monastery before you depart.
